🌍 𝐀𝐒𝐄𝐀𝐍 𝐋𝐚𝐛𝐨𝐮𝐫 𝐋𝐞𝐚𝐝𝐞𝐫𝐬 𝐔𝐧𝐢𝐭𝐞 𝐨𝐧 𝐭𝐡𝐞 𝐅𝐮𝐭𝐮𝐫𝐞 𝐨𝐟 𝐖𝐨𝐫𝐤
The 𝐖𝐨𝐫𝐥𝐝 𝐄𝐜𝐨𝐧𝐨𝐦𝐢𝐜 𝐅𝐨𝐫𝐮𝐦 (WEF) and 𝐓𝐚𝐥𝐞𝐧𝐭𝐂𝐨𝐫𝐩 co-hosted a high-level roundtable at the 2025 International Labour Conference in Geneva, bringing together regional ministers and global partners for a focused dialogue on workforce transformation.
Opening the session, WEF Managing Director 𝐌𝐬. 𝐒𝐚𝐚𝐝𝐢𝐚 𝐙𝐚𝐡𝐢𝐝 shared key insights from the Forum’s Future of Jobs 2025 report. With AI, the green economy, and geopolitical shifts reshaping labour markets, she stressed, “This is not something any country or business should be thinking about separately. There is value in coordination, collaboration, and co-creation.”

NEW: Generative AI is already taking white collar jobs
An ingenious study by @xianghui90@oren_reshef@Zhou_Yu_AI looked at what happened on a huge online freelancing platform after ChatGPT launched last year.
The answer? Freelancers got fewer jobs, and earned much less
